While FabSugar attended the Peter Som fashion show last season, they were unable to make it on this trip—but that's okay. BellaSugar's got the goods on how to create the sexy, tousled hair from this season's Spring 2008 show.
The goal of lead hairstylist Eugene Souleiman was to have runway hair that looked fresh, young and natural, with a slight edge.

Last week, our FabSugar team attended the VPL Spring 2008 Fashion Show. While the clothing was sheer and chic, and the makeup was pretty and plain, the hair was va va voom!
While most of us do whatever we can to fight the frizzies, hairstylist extraordinaire Neil Moodie, created a wild, crimped 'do that made those frizzies, kinda flattering.

Crazy club-kid duo Heatherette isn't known for being subtle, and its models' hairstyles were as over-the-top as you'd expect. I thought it was a lot of fun, and very young—it reminded me of the way my friends and I would play "hairdresser" as girls.
If you like the winged metallic eyeliner shown here on Chanel Iman (yes, that's her real name), you'll be excited to know that Heatherette will soon have its own makeup line, complete with the lovely Lydia Hearst as its campaign face!

He's been on my radar for a while now, but since I finally got to see his work in person, it's confirmed: 27-year-old Toronto-based designer Jeremy Laing is definitely one to watch. These pictures, from his Spring collection, don't do them justice. Especially because a lot of the finer details are in the backs of his designs, which you can't see in my runway pictures.
